Description

Developed for use with a router table, this joinery jig lets you accurately cut dovetails and box joints in stock up to 15 1/2" wide. It produces through dovetails with pins spaced on 1 1/2" centers and box joints with 3/32", 3/16", 3/8" or 3/4" fingers in stock from 1/8" to 1" thick. Half-blind dovetails can be cut in material from 1/2" to 1" thick. With an optional guide bushing (sold separately) and a 0.313" straight cutter, you can also cut through dovetails with a 3/4" pin spacing. Optional and included bushings each fit table openings with a 1 3/16" through bore and a 1 3/8" counterbore.

Made largely of anodized aluminum, the jig has a two-piece design that uses an extruded beam to hold the stock perpendicular to a CNC-machined template. Adjustable side stops allow repeatable positioning, and have an offset for registering a rabbeted drawer front. Fast-acting cam clamps reliably hold the work against a non-marring textured clamping surface. An eccentric guide bushing lets you accurately change the distance between the cutter and template, eliminating the need to fine tune jig position for joint fit. When cutting 3/4" box joints or through tails spaced 1 1/2" on center, you can use the included filler blocks to occupy the template recesses not being used. Interchangeable instruction cards provide an overview of the set-up required for each joint, and slip into a channel in the top of the beam for quick reference.

Compatible with 1/2" routers, it comes with everything needed to get started: 8° and 14° 1/2" dovetail cutters plus 1/2" × 1 1/4" and 3/8" x1" straight cutters (all with 1/2" shanks), an eccentric guide bushing, a router bit height gauge, ten filler blocks, five instruction cards and a 76-page manual.
